A wide range of ancient Eastern and modern Western philosophies are connected in this exciting new therapy. Free your bodily tensions and release long-held emotions, enhancing your mental and physical health. Rosenberg's Integrative Body Psychotherapy helps develop both personal and internal growth, focusing on the whole person — the body, mind, emotions and spirit.An integration of various disciplines, this approach is ideal for professionals looking to develop a holistic and integrated philosophy of health. This book helps both professionals and lay readers learn:-The basic tools of Integrative Body Psychotherapy-Segments of the body, and how they work together-The stages in development of the self-The physical/energetic level of sexuality-The intra-psychic level of sexuality-The interpersonal level of sexuality-The transpersonal experienceWhat readers are saying about this book:The authors' broad perspective is a welcome relief from the narrowness of most self-development systems.
